Update: President Cyril Ramaphosa will address the nation tomorrow.

 

President Cyril Ramaphosa was due to address the nation this evening following several meetings about the coronavirus.

However, he’s been locked in a meeting with the national command council dealing with Covid-19 that is expected to continue late into the night.

Minister in the Presidency Jackson Mthembu said the President has been discussing pressing issues with the council, including the socio-economic impact of the novel virus and He supposed to gather all the information before He can address the nation and possibility is that the President will address the nation tomorrow.

So far total of 240 South Africans have tested positive for the novel virus.

Ramaphosa has since declared the outbreak a state of national disaster and implemented stringent measures to contain the spread of Covid-19 in the country.
